Tim Federowicz won't return as Triple-A Toledo manager


The Detroit Tigers will have a new manager in Triple-A Toledo. , a former UNC and MLB catcher, won't return to the Mud Hens or the Tigers' organization for the 2025 season, per multiple sources with knowledge of the situation. The 37-year-old worked for the Tigers as the MLB catching coach in 2023 and Triple-A manager in 2024. (Yahoo! Sports)
